"Eretz Nehederet" is taking Iran by storm, as a sketch featuring the son of the late Ali Khamenei has gone viral among regime opponents. Iranian influencer Ali Esmayli, known for his fierce opposition to the Ayatollah regime, shared the satirical take on Mojtaba Khamenei’s appointment as Supreme Leader. The video garnered hundreds of thousands of views after being posted across Esmayli’s accounts.
The sketch (featuring actors Mariano Idelman, Yuval Semo, and Dor Muskul) depicts the selection process of the new leader with sharp ridicule, portraying Mojtaba Khamenei being chosen "against his will." The selection was parodied through children's games such as musical chairs and "one out of three," mocking the legitimacy of the succession.
